Embracing the Kansas City Aesthetic
Kansas City’s personality is a vibrant mix of history, culture, and innovation, all reflected in its architecture and design. The city boasts a distinctive architectural heritage, including the iconic Art Deco buildings, charming Craftsman bungalows, and modern lofts in the downtown area. Homeowners in the area often seek to blend these historical elements with contemporary decor, creating a unique and inviting atmosphere. Whether you are searching for inspiration for a new home, or looking to refresh your current one, Kansas City offers a plethora of styles to inspire you.
The Influence of Local History and Culture
Kansas City’s rich history, particularly its connection to jazz music and the flourishing arts scene, profoundly affects its design preferences. Homes often feature elements that nod to the city’s musical roots, incorporating warm, earthy tones reminiscent of vintage instruments. Artwork by local artists, reflecting the energy of the city’s vibrant cultural life, is also common. Moreover, the strong community spirit fosters a desire for comfortable, welcoming spaces ideal for hosting gatherings. This historical and cultural influence is what makes Kansas City home decor so special.
- Jazz and Blues Influence: Many interiors incorporate colors, textures, and patterns that mimic the feeling of a jazz club. Think rich browns, deep blues, and subtle brass accents, reflecting the instruments and the mood.
- Art Deco Inspiration: Incorporating geometric patterns, bold colors, and sleek lines, reminiscent of the city’s historic buildings, is also a good approach. The use of mirrors, chrome, and luxurious fabrics enhances the glamorous ambiance.
- Prairie School Elements: The Prairie School movement, with its emphasis on nature and craftsmanship, also plays a part. Homes may feature handcrafted furniture, natural materials like wood and stone, and large windows that connect the indoors with the outdoors.

Popular Home Decor Shops and Boutiques
Kansas City boasts a selection of home decor stores, catering to varied tastes and budgets. Some establishments specialize in antiques, while others offer a curated selection of modern furnishings. Many of these shops emphasize locally sourced products, ensuring that you can find one-of-a-kind items reflecting the city’s unique style. There is also an abundance of design professionals that call Kansas City home.
- Antique Stores: Exploring antique stores is an excellent starting point. Stores such as the Westside Storey offer unique vintage furniture, decor, and collectibles. The ability to discover a one-of-a-kind item, is really rewarding.
- Modern Furniture Boutiques: Stores like Trazo and DesignQuest curate modern furniture and decor items. Their offerings often include pieces from local designers and artisans. This is especially good for those with more modern tastes.
- Specialty Shops: Explore specialty stores that focus on specific styles. Stores like Nell Hill’s offer the ability to find unique elements and design ideas. You might also be able to find a local design professional.

Frequently Asked Questions
Question: Where can I find local art and crafts in Kansas City?
Answer: You can explore local galleries, art fairs, and specialty shops to find unique pieces by Kansas City artists and craftspeople. The Crossroads Arts District, West 18th Street, and the River Market are excellent places to start your search.
Question: How do I incorporate Kansas City’s architectural styles into my decor?
Answer: Research the architectural styles of Kansas City and identify elements you like. Use the same colors and materials as your favorite architectural styles, like the Art Deco, Prairie School, or Craftsman, into your home decor.
